Output 39d9782a4fb0253ae5630828654be23e6a1d98844336eb278519ef667458ed25:32

value
2390176
script pubkey
OP_0 OP_PUSHBYTES_20 daabf133b8c32a3063412e7b398057dccfa2aff0
address
bc1qm24lzvaccv4rqc6p9eannqzhmn869tlsfw29a8
transaction
39d9782a4fb0253ae5630828654be23e6a1d98844336eb278519ef667458ed25
spent
true